Position: Associate Digital Producer (Newsletters)

Cyber Guy is seeking an experienced and highly knowledgeable Associate Digital Producer to join our team.

This role plays a key part in the daily production and optimization of
The Cyber Guy Report
and related newsletters
. Newsletters are central to how we reach and engage our audience, and this position helps ensure they are accurate, compelling, on-brand, and performance-driven.

The Associate Digital Producer works closely with the Lead Digital Producer to prepare, proof, test, and publish daily newsletters in a fast-paced tech news environment. In addition to newsletter production, this role supports broader digital publishing efforts, including article review, research, analytics, content distribution, and pre-publish quality assurance across platforms.

Key Responsibilities
  • Support the daily production, formatting, QA, and publishing of digital newsletters
  • Write, edit, and refine newsletter copy, headlines, previews, and calls-to-action
  • Proofread and quality-check all newsletter content for clarity, accuracy, formatting, links, and compliance
  • Schedule, test, and send newsletters using email platforms, ensuring consistent delivery across devices
  • Coordinate newsletter content with articles, videos, sponsor placements, and breaking tech news
  • Monitor and report on newsletter performance, including open rates, click-through rates, and engagement
  • Assist with newsletter optimization, including subject lines, layout, and send timing
  • Review and proof articles, scripts, and supporting copy for grammar, accuracy, and tone
  • Research and verify story topics, sources, and claims as needed
  • Manage Word Press updates, including article formatting, metadata, tags, and featured images
  • Support interactive content modules, including games, quizzes, puzzles, polls, and other engagement features within newsletters
  • Work within established automation and publishing workflows, helping QA automated sends, templates, and content handoffs across tools
  • Create and resize basic visual assets and thumbnails using design tools
  • Review and QA scheduled social media posts for accuracy, clarity, links, and brand voice prior to publishing
  • Maintain organized editorial workflows, documentation, and publishing schedules
